Boston radio show host, Michael Felger, spouted off a few days ago saying Roy Halladay “Got what he deserved”and called Halladay a “Moron” shortly after seeing video which has surfaced that points to the fact that Roy Halladay operated his plane in a reckless manner, which in turn caused his death.
